Fly Infestation Extermination Questions
What causes fly infestations around properties? Flies are attracted to food waste, standing water, and decaying organic matter, which provide ideal breeding sites.
How can property owners prevent fly infestations? Removing trash, cleaning up spills, and eliminating standing water can reduce attractants for flies.
What signs indicate a fly infestation? A sudden increase in flies indoors or around trash areas, along with visible fly activity, suggests an infestation.
What areas are typically treated during fly extermination? Treatments often target breeding sites, entry points, and areas with high fly activity to control the infestation effectively.
